When using an XBox-compatible controller on PC, character movement is no longer fluid after Patch 1.1.0a.
To reproduce:
Connect XBox controller to PC (tested with both XB1 controller with dongle and 8BitDo Ultimate)
1a. Tested with male Barbarian
Set Inner Dead Zone to 0
Set Outer Dead Zone to 0
Slowly move the left stick until character begins to move walk
Continue moving the left stick the same direction and note that the character will stop moving near 50% of the stick travel
Continue moving the left stick the same direction and note that the character suddenly transitions to a “fast jog” (appears to be one notch under full speed)
Continue moving the left stick the same direction to maximum throw and the character moves at full speed
Slowly back off the left stick back toward the center and note that the character will appear to slow down with a small skip in the animation
Note that setting Outer Dead Zone to at least 3 seems to alleviate some of this issue. However, upon closer inspection, the animation stutter/skip is still apparent, especially when the character is slowing down.
I don’t think this is a technical issue pertaining to just my set up (and it’s not affecting my
ability to start/install the game). This only started happening after today’s patch. I also tested with two different controllers and changed my character speed with gear - the issue is persistent.
